From graphing calculators to interactive notebooks, Python eases you into programming, no GOTOs required.
Essential Ways to Run a Python Script Python is one of the most popular programming languages today, widely praised for its simplicity and versatility. Whether you’re a beginner dipping your toes into ...
Thibault Sottiaux helped make AI coding one of OpenAI’s fastest-growing businesses. Now he’s overseeing a sweeping overhaul ...
Researchers have uncovered a supply-chain attack that hides in Python packages, propagates like a worm, and tricks LLM-based ...
Dozens of cryptographically verified open source packages from Microsoft were compromised late last week to add advanced credential-stealing code that was triggered when developers opened them in AI ...
The Miasma supply chain campaign has sparked a fresh attack wave called Hades, this time involving 37 malicious wheel ...
By encoding mathematical statements into numbers, mathematician Kurt Gödel used ordinary arithmetic to check whether a ...
Vibe coding might sound like a hipster on a surfboard with a MacBook, but it’s actually a simple way to describe creating computer code using artificial intelligence. Instead of writing every line of ...
For computer engineering students eager to enter the market, vibe coding presents an unprecedented equaliser, believes Deepak Dhanak. (Image generated by AI) As a science student and a coding aspirant ...
It was in early 2025 when Andrej Karpathy, the influential former OpenAI and Tesla AI leader, coined the term vibe coding.” The phrase described a fundamental shift in software development – coders ...
It’s a weird time to be studying computer science. Recent grads have a higher unemployment rate than those in just about every other major—yes, even philosophy. The internet is littered with rants 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results